蓝易云CDN:高防CDN如何加速网站访问速度?

📌高防CDN加速网站的核心技术解析
高防CDN通过智能网络架构协议优化实现网站加速,其核心逻辑是缩短用户与资源的物理距离并优化数据传输效率。以下是具体实现机制:


一、加速原理分步拆解

1. 全球节点覆盖与智能调度

  • 节点布局:高防CDN在全球部署数百个边缘节点(如蓝易云覆盖50+国家)。
  • 调度算法
    • 基于用户IP的GeoDNS解析,将请求分配至最近的节点(例如上海用户访问华东节点)。
    • 实时监测节点负载,自动规避拥堵线路(延迟降低40%-80%)。

2. 静态资源缓存优化

  • 边缘缓存策略
    location ~* \.(jpg|css|js)$ {  
        expires 30d;  
        add_header Cache-Control "public";  
    }  
    

    解释:将图片、CSS、JS等静态文件缓存30天,减少80%以上的回源请求。

  • 缓存分层
    • 热点内容存储在L1边缘节点(靠近用户)。
    • 低频内容存储在L2区域中心节点,按需拉取。

3. 动态内容加速技术

  • 协议优化
    • 采用HTTP/3协议替代HTTP/1.1,通过QUIC协议解决TCP队头阻塞问题,提升并发性能。
    • BGP多线接入:智能选择最优运营商链路(降低跨网延迟)。
  • 数据压缩
    • 启用Brotli压缩(比Gzip效率高15%-25%),减少传输体积。
    brotli on;  
    brotli_comp_level 6;  
    brotli_types text/plain text/css application/json;  
    

    解释:对文本类文件启用Brotli压缩,压缩级别设为6(平衡速度与压缩率)。

4. TCP/UDP层优化

  • TCP Fast Open(TFO):减少三次握手次数,降低首字节时间(TTFB)。
  • BBR拥塞控制算法:替代传统CUBIC算法,提升高延迟、高丢包场景下的吞吐量。


二、高防CDN与传统CDN加速对比表

技术维度 传统CDN 高防CDN
节点响应速度 依赖本地缓存 边缘计算实时处理
动态内容处理 仅支持基础缓存 智能路由+协议优化
网络链路选择 单线或双线BGP 多线BGP+AI调度
抗干扰能力 易受DDoS影响延迟飙升 攻击流量清洗不干扰正常请求

三、关键性能指标实测数据

  • 延迟降低:东京→洛杉矶用户访问延迟从220ms降至85ms(降幅61%)。
  • 首屏加载时间:电商网站首屏渲染时间从3.2s缩短至1.1s(基于HTTP/3)。
  • 带宽成本:通过压缩与缓存,降低源站带宽消耗70%以上。

四、实际应用场景与配置建议

1. 高并发场景(如电商秒杀)

  • 配置示例
    # 启用连接数限制与缓存锁  
    proxy_cache_lock on;  
    proxy_cache_lock_timeout 5s;  
    limit_conn_zone $server_name zone=perserver:10m;  
    limit_conn perserver 1000;  
    

    解释:限制单个服务器并发连接数不超过1000,防止过载,同时用缓存锁避免重复回源。

2. 视频流媒体加速

  • 分片传输优化
    mp4;  
    mp4_buffer_size 4m;  
    mp4_max_buffer_size 10m;  
    

    解释:针对MP4视频文件启用流媒体分片传输,提升加载流畅度。

3. 全球化业务部署

  • 多语言智能路由
    • 根据用户Accept-Language头自动分发对应语言版本页面。
    • 结合Anycast IP实现跨国访问最短路径。

五、技术原理解析表(WordPress兼容格式)

加速模块 技术实现细节
静态资源加速 边缘节点缓存 + 缓存命中率监控 + 过期内容主动预热
动态API加速 智能路由(Anycast) + QUIC协议 + 边缘计算实时压缩
安全加速协同 DDoS清洗与流量加速并行处理,攻击流量不进入核心链路

🚀总结:高防CDN通过“物理层优化+协议层创新”的双重策略,将网站访问速度提升至毫秒级响应。其核心价值不仅是“加速”,更是通过安全防护与网络调度的深度整合,实现业务连续性的全面保障。

THE END